PI6C49X0204BWIEX - Diodes Incorporated - Clock/Timing - Clock Buffers, Drivers

PI6C49X0204BWIEX

Diodes Incorporated

1 TO 4 LVCMOS/ LVTTL FANOUT BUFF

PI6C49X0204BWIEX is a Clock/Timing - Clock Buffers, Drivers manufactured by Diodes Incorporated. 1 TO 4 LVCMOS/ LVTTL FANOUT BUFF. Key specifications: mounting type Surface Mount, operating temperature -40°C ~ 85°C (TA), voltage - supply 1.6V ~ 3.465V, package / case 8-SOIC (0.154", 3.90mm Width).
